What Is a Breakout in Cryptocurrency Trading?

A breakout in cryptocurrency trading occurs when the price of a digital asset moves beyond a previously established support or resistance level. It’s a significant price movement that often signals the start of a new trend or the continuation of an existing one. Breakouts typically happen with increased trading volume, indicating strong market sentiment.

Identifying Support and Resistance Levels

Support and resistance levels form the foundation of breakout strategies. These price points act as barriers that can either contain or propel market movements:

  • Support levels: These are price floors where downward trends typically pause or reverse. Buyers often step in at these levels, creating a temporary bottom.
  • Resistance levels: Acting as price ceilings, resistance levels are where upward trends may stall or turn around. Sellers tend to become more active at these points.

Traders watch for price breaks above resistance or below support, as these can signal the start of new trends. Identifying these levels accurately is crucial for timing entries and exits in breakout trades.

Utilizing Volume Analysis

Volume analysis is a critical component in confirming the validity of breakouts:

  • Volume confirmation: A true breakout is often accompanied by a surge in trading volume. This increased activity suggests strong market participation and can indicate the sustainability of the new price direction.
  • Volume divergence: When price and volume trends don’t align, it can signal potential breakouts or breakdowns. For example, rising prices with declining volume might indicate a weakening trend and a possible reversal.

By incorporating volume analysis, traders can better assess the strength and potential longevity of breakouts, reducing the risk of false signals.

Incorporating Technical Indicators

Technical indicators complement support/resistance levels and volume analysis in breakout strategies:

  • Moving averages: These help identify overall trends and potential breakout points. Crossovers of short-term and long-term moving averages can signal trend changes.
  • Relative Strength Index (RSI): This momentum indicator can help confirm breakouts by showing overbought or oversold conditions.
  • Bollinger Bands: These bands expand during increased volatility, often indicating potential breakouts. Price movements outside the bands can signal strong trend shifts.

By combining these indicators with other analysis techniques, traders can develop more robust and reliable breakout strategies in the crypto market.

Rectangle Pattern Breakout

Rectangle pattern breakouts occur when the price breaks out of a period of price congestion. This pattern forms when the price moves sideways between two parallel horizontal lines, creating a rectangle shape on the chart. Traders watch for a breakout above the upper resistance line or below the lower support line, which can signal the start of a new trend. To trade this pattern:

  1. Identify the rectangle pattern on the chart
  2. Wait for a price break above resistance or below support
  3. Confirm the breakout with increased trading volume
  4. Set a stop-loss order just inside the rectangle
  5. Target a price move equal to the height of the rectangle

Triangle Pattern Breakout

Triangle patterns are common in crypto trading and come in three types: ascending, descending, and symmetrical. Each type has its own characteristics and trading implications:

  • Ascending triangle: Bullish pattern with a flat upper resistance line and rising lower support line
  • Descending triangle: Bearish pattern with a flat lower support line and falling upper resistance line
  • Symmetrical triangle: Neutral pattern with converging support and resistance lines

To trade triangle breakouts:

  1. Identify the triangle pattern and its type
  2. Wait for a price break above resistance or below support
  3. Confirm the breakout with increased volume
  4. Set a stop-loss just inside the triangle
  5. Target a price move equal to the height of the triangle at its widest point

Flag and Pennant Breakouts

Flag and pennant patterns are short-term continuation patterns that often form after a strong price move. These patterns represent brief pauses in the trend before the price continues in the original direction:

  • Flag: Rectangular shape that slopes against the prevailing trend
  • Pennant: Small symmetrical triangle that forms after a sharp price move
  1. Identify the flag or pennant pattern following a strong price move
  2. Wait for a breakout in the direction of the original trend
  3. Confirm the breakout with increased volume
  4. Set a stop-loss just below the flag or pennant
  5. Target a price move equal to the length of the flagpole (the sharp move preceding the pattern)

Setting Stop-Loss Orders

Stop-loss orders are essential safeguards in crypto breakout trading. They automatically close a position if the price moves against you, limiting potential losses. When setting stop-losses for breakout trades:

  • Place the stop-loss just below the breakout level for long positions or just above for short positions
  • Use a percentage-based stop-loss, typically 2-5% of your account balance
  • Adjust stop-losses as the trade moves in your favor to lock in profits
  • Consider using trailing stop-losses to capture more upside while protecting gains

Remember, crypto markets can be prone to false breakouts and sudden reversals. Properly placed stop-losses help protect your capital when trades don’t go as planned.

Position Sizing Techniques

Proper position sizing is critical for managing risk in crypto breakout trading. Here are some effective techniques:

  • Fixed percentage: Risk a set percentage (e.g., 1-2%) of your trading account on each trade
  • Kelly Criterion: Use this formula to determine optimal position size based on win rate and risk-reward ratio
  • Volatility-based sizing: Adjust position size based on the cryptocurrency’s recent volatility
  • Scaling in: Enter a position gradually as the breakout confirms, reducing risk of false breakouts

By carefully managing position sizes, we can survive losing streaks and capitalize on winning trades without risking too much on any single opportunity.

Dealing with False Breakouts

False breakouts are a common headache in crypto trading. They occur when the price appears to break through a support or resistance level, only to reverse course quickly. This can throw off even experienced traders and lead to unnecessary losses.

To minimize the impact of false breakouts:

  • Use confirmation signals like increased volume or candlestick patterns
  • Wait for a candle close beyond the breakout level before entering a trade
  • Set wider stop-losses to account for market noise
  • Carry out time-based filters to ensure the breakout is sustained

Remember, patience is key. It’s better to miss out on some potential profits than to get caught in a false breakout trap.

Volatility and Liquidity Considerations

Crypto markets are notorious for their extreme volatility and varying liquidity levels. These factors can significantly impact the effectiveness of breakout strategies:

Volatility challenges:

  • Rapid price swings can trigger stop-losses prematurely
  • High volatility can lead to slippage, affecting entry and exit prices
  • Emotional decision-making becomes more likely in highly volatile conditions

Liquidity issues:

  • Low liquidity in some cryptocurrencies can result in wider bid-ask spreads
  • Thin order books make it harder to execute large trades without affecting price
  • Illiquid markets are more susceptible to manipulation and sudden price movements

To navigate these challenges:

  1. Adjust position sizes based on market volatility
  2. Focus on more liquid cryptocurrencies for breakout trades
  3. Use limit orders instead of market orders to control entry and exit prices
  4. Consider implementing volatility-based filters in your trading strategy

By acknowledging these limitations and adapting our strategies accordingly, we can improve our chances of success in the dynamic world of crypto breakout trading.
